Table of Contents

biānyì: 编译 - To Compile, Edit and Translate

Quick Summary

Core Meaning

Character Breakdown

When combined, 编译 (biānyì) creates a wonderfully descriptive metaphor for compiling code: it's the process of organizing (编) the source code and translating (译) it from a high-level language (like Python or C++) into a low-level machine language.

Cultural Context and Significance

Practical Usage in Modern China

In Software Development (Primary Use)

This is the most common context for `编译`. It is used formally and informally among developers, in technical documentation, university courses, and user interfaces of development tools. Its meaning is a direct one-to-one equivalent of the English “compile.”

In Publishing and Academia (Less Common)

In a more literary or academic context, `编译` can refer to the act of compiling a work by editing and translating various sources. For example, creating a new textbook by adapting and translating material from several foreign books could be described as `编译`. This usage is much less frequent than the programming meaning.

Example Sentences

Nuances and Common Mistakes